Understanding the Basics

Firebase, a product of Google, offers a variety of services that help streamline app development. When we talk about sending emails in the context of Firebase, it usually involves using Firebase Authentication and a third-party service like SendGrid or SMTP providers. Let's break down the basic steps you need to follow.

  1. Set Up Firebase Project: Start by creating a new project in the Firebase console. This is where you will manage your app's data and settings.
  2. Enable Authentication: Navigate to the Authentication section and enable email/password authentication. This allows users to create accounts and log in using their email addresses.
  3. Integrate Email Service: Choose an email service provider (ESP) such as SendGrid or SMTP. Firebase does not natively support email sending but can be integrated with these services to send emails directly from your app.
  4. Set Up Backend Function: Use Firebase Cloud Functions to trigger email sending events, such as when a user registers or when a password reset is requested.

Best Practices and Tips

To maximize the effectiveness of your email sending capabilities through Firebase, consider the following best practices:

1. Ensure Email Deliverability

Use a verified sending domain with your ESP to improve deliverability rates. This helps your emails avoid spam filters and reach your users' inboxes.

2. Monitor Email Performance

Keep track of key performance metrics such as open rates, click-through rates, and bounce rates. Tools offered by services like SendGrid can help you analyze these metrics, allowing you to improve your email campaigns.

3. put in place User Preferences

Allow users to manage their email preferences directly within your app. This not only enhances user satisfaction but also reduces unsubscribes and spam complaints.

4. Automate Workflows

use Firebase Cloud Functions to automate sending emails. For instance, you can set up a function that automatically sends a welcome email when a new user registers on your platform. This reduces manual effort and ensures timely communication.

Common Challenges and Solutions

While sending emails through Firebase can be straightforward, you may encounter some challenges. Here’s how to address them:

1. Email Not Reaching Inbox

If your emails are landing in users' spam folders, ensure that your domain is authenticated. put in place DKIM and SPF records to improve your domain's credibility.

2. Rate Limiting

Most ESPs have rate limits on how many emails you can send in a given timeframe. Be mindful of these limits, especially during high-traffic periods. Consider batching emails or using a queue system to manage your sending rate effectively.

3. User Unsubscribes

If you notice a high unsubscribe rate, consider conducting surveys to understand user preferences and adjust your email content accordingly. Providing value in your emails is key to keeping users subscribed.

4. Integration Complexity

Integrating Firebase with an ESP can be complex. Ensure to follow detailed documentation provided by both Firebase and your chosen ESP. Online communities and forums can also serve as valuable resources for troubleshooting.
